The last time we were in Budapest was a chilly December 2010, it was the first time we had travelled overseas and it was love at first site! After visiting numerous European cities we both still hold a special place for Budapest so we were very excited to return and it did not disappoint. It is definitely a very different city in summer, beautiful green trees lining the roads instead of knee deep snow.

Our stop this time was brief, but we knew exactly what we wanted to see and do and it was achievable. Last time we had neglected to go to the famous thermal baths, so this was on our list along with getting up close to the parliament house which is a magnificent building. Along with this we were keen to visit Trophia, a Hungarian buffet restaurant that a Hungarian we met in Africa insisted that we visit.

We arrived in Budapest late at night from Krakow on a bus with squeaky breaks and in need of a service. Our hostel was right in the city center, which meant everything was in walking distance. We woke the first morning ready to hit the baths but decided the weather was not quite hot enough and instead went in search of breakfast, this was harder than we thought, and the prices in Budapest had increased since our last visit. Instead of paying far too much for some eggs and toast we settled on chocolate milk and a muesli bar (a healthy choice). We spent the morning walking along the river and admiring the view of the parliament house, in the afternoon we wondered around Margret Island, an Island in the middle of the Danube River. Here we rented a two person peddle bike which we rode in perfect unison through the gardens and water fountains.

That night after consuming the least amount of food possible all day we hit Trophia, all you can eat traditional Hungarian food, seafood, meats, salads, soup (goulash of course) deserts and all you can drink, local beer, wine and cocktails. We had a great night out even sharing in 21st birthday cake from the locals sitting at the table next to us! After quite a few drinks Aaron got so excited he lit his napkin on fire with the candle on our table and then tried to blow it out only causing the fire to get bigger. Our night was so good in fact we returned the following night (lucky they didn’t recognise Aaron after his fire incident) with a group from our hostel and definitely got our money’s worth!

Our second day was spent almost entirely at the thermal baths, which was very relaxing swapping from warm to cool baths (not quite sure of the medical benefits but we did feel very clean!). Early the next morning we woke up and took a train to Belgrade.
